Senator Sessions,
I am angry. Not at you personally, but at the over reaching of the federal government at every level.
I would like to suggest that you bring up a bill that simply states the following :
"All future and current spending and/or taxation bills must show how they are specifically authorized by the United States Constitution, if they can not show that they are, they will never get a vote or be renewed."
(It would need something to preclude every thing using the general welfare argument).
If they can't show it they are not renewed or they are never voted on. It does not need to be pages and pages one well formulated sentence will suffice.
I know that this bill would probably never see the light of day, but if you were to publicize it before you introduced it, it may at least get the people of the country thinking, and our elected officials may receive a reminder that they are supposed to work for us, not against us.
